Installer ultimate-general-civil-war-gog

files:
- setup: N/A:Select the GOG installer
game:
  appid: 502520
  arch: win64
  exe: drive_c/GOG Games/Ultimate General Civil War/Ultimate General Civil War.exe
  prefix: $GAMEDIR
installer:
- task:
    args: /SILENT /SP- /NOCANCEL /SUPPRESSMSGBOXES
    executable: setup
    name: wineexec
    prefix: $GAMEDIR
- task:
    app: dxvk
    description: Installing dxvk, this could take a while...
    name: winetricks
    prefix: $GAMEDIR
- task:
    app: vcrun2010
    description: Installing vcrun2010, this could take a while...
    name: winetricks
    prefix: $GAMEDIR
- task:
    key: Screenmanager Is Fullscreen mode_h3981298716
    name: set_regedit
    path: HKEY_CURRENT_USER\Software\Game Labs\Ultimate General Civil War
    prefix: $GAMEDIR
    type: REG_DWORD
    value: '00000000'
- task:
    key: Screenmanager Resolution Height_h2627697771
    name: set_regedit
    path: HKEY_CURRENT_USER\Software\Game Labs\Ultimate General Civil War
    prefix: $GAMEDIR
    type: REG_DWORD
    value: 438
- task:
    key: Screenmanager Resolution Width_h182942802
    name: set_regedit
    path: HKEY_CURRENT_USER\Software\Game Labs\Ultimate General Civil War
    prefix: $GAMEDIR
    type: REG_DWORD
    value: 780
- wine:
    esync: true
description: ''
game_slug: ultimate-general-civil-war
gogslug: ultimate_general_civil_war
humblestoreid: ''
installer_slug: ultimate-general-civil-war-gog
name: 'Ultimate General: Civil War'
notes: "Game internally uses your main monitors resolution, you can't change that\
  \ (afaik). \r\nInstaller prepares game for 1920x1080 windowed mode, change resolution\
  \ in registry if necessary.\r\nIf using only one monitor or all your monitors have\
  \ the same resolution, you can switch into full screen mode.\r\nIf using multi monitors\
  \ and your monitors have different resolutions: Change the registry keys to something\
  \ representing your desired monitor resolution. Game will only work on the monitor\
  \ it first pops up, won't survive dragging around screens."
runner: wine
script:
  files:
  - setup: N/A:Select the GOG installer
  game:
    appid: 502520
    arch: win64
    exe: drive_c/GOG Games/Ultimate General Civil War/Ultimate General Civil War.exe
    prefix: $GAMEDIR
  installer:
  - task:
      args: /SILENT /SP- /NOCANCEL /SUPPRESSMSGBOXES
      executable: setup
      name: wineexec
      prefix: $GAMEDIR
  - task:
      app: dxvk
      description: Installing dxvk, this could take a while...
      name: winetricks
      prefix: $GAMEDIR
  - task:
      app: vcrun2010
      description: Installing vcrun2010, this could take a while...
      name: winetricks
      prefix: $GAMEDIR
  - task:
      key: Screenmanager Is Fullscreen mode_h3981298716
      name: set_regedit
      path: HKEY_CURRENT_USER\Software\Game Labs\Ultimate General Civil War
      prefix: $GAMEDIR
      type: REG_DWORD
      value: '00000000'
  - task:
      key: Screenmanager Resolution Height_h2627697771
      name: set_regedit
      path: HKEY_CURRENT_USER\Software\Game Labs\Ultimate General Civil War
      prefix: $GAMEDIR
      type: REG_DWORD
      value: 438
  - task:
      key: Screenmanager Resolution Width_h182942802
      name: set_regedit
      path: HKEY_CURRENT_USER\Software\Game Labs\Ultimate General Civil War
      prefix: $GAMEDIR
      type: REG_DWORD
      value: 780
  - wine:
      esync: true
slug: ultimate-general-civil-war-gog
steamid: 502520
version: GOG
year: 2017
{
  "game_slug": "ultimate-general-civil-war",
  "version": "GOG",
  "description": "",
  "notes": "Game internally uses your main monitors resolution, you can't change that (afaik). \r\nInstaller prepares game for 1920x1080 windowed mode, change resolution in registry if necessary.\r\nIf using only one monitor or all your monitors have the same resolution, you can switch into full screen mode.\r\nIf using multi monitors and your monitors have different resolutions: Change the registry keys to something representing your desired monitor resolution. Game will only work on the monitor it first pops up, won't survive dragging around screens.",
  "name": "Ultimate General: Civil War",
  "year": 2017,
  "steamid": 502520,
  "gogslug": "ultimate_general_civil_war",
  "humblestoreid": "",
  "runner": "wine",
  "slug": "ultimate-general-civil-war-gog",
  "installer_slug": "ultimate-general-civil-war-gog",
  "script": {
    "files": [
      {
        "setup": "N/A:Select the GOG installer"
      }
    ],
    "game": {
      "appid": 502520,
      "arch": "win64",
      "exe": "drive_c/GOG Games/Ultimate General Civil War/Ultimate General Civil War.exe",
      "prefix": "$GAMEDIR"
    },
    "installer": [
      {
        "task": {
          "args": "/SILENT /SP- /NOCANCEL /SUPPRESSMSGBOXES",
          "executable": "setup",
          "name": "wineexec",
          "prefix": "$GAMEDIR"
        }
      },
      {
        "task": {
          "app": "dxvk",
          "description": "Installing dxvk, this could take a while...",
          "name": "winetricks",
          "prefix": "$GAMEDIR"
        }
      },
      {
        "task": {
          "app": "vcrun2010",
          "description": "Installing vcrun2010, this could take a while...",
          "name": "winetricks",
          "prefix": "$GAMEDIR"
        }
      },
      {
        "task": {
          "key": "Screenmanager Is Fullscreen mode_h3981298716",
          "name": "set_regedit",
          "path": "HKEY_CURRENT_USER\\Software\\Game Labs\\Ultimate General Civil War",
          "prefix": "$GAMEDIR",
          "type": "REG_DWORD",
          "value": "00000000"
        }
      },
      {
        "task": {
          "key": "Screenmanager Resolution Height_h2627697771",
          "name": "set_regedit",
          "path": "HKEY_CURRENT_USER\\Software\\Game Labs\\Ultimate General Civil War",
          "prefix": "$GAMEDIR",
          "type": "REG_DWORD",
          "value": 438
        }
      },
      {
        "task": {
          "key": "Screenmanager Resolution Width_h182942802",
          "name": "set_regedit",
          "path": "HKEY_CURRENT_USER\\Software\\Game Labs\\Ultimate General Civil War",
          "prefix": "$GAMEDIR",
          "type": "REG_DWORD",
          "value": 780
        }
      },
      {
        "wine": {
          "esync": true
        }
      }
    ]
  }
}
Back to game